Welcome to the heating guide for Big Hill, situated in postcode 3232. Utilising data from the nearest weather station (LORNE PIER HEAD) at an elevation of 4 metres above sea level, which started operating in 1969 with the latest data recorded in 1986, we can analyse the temperature trends crucial for your home's heating needs.

In this region, winters have recorded temperatures as low as 2.2 degrees C, highlighting the necessity for energy-efficient heating systems. During these colder months (June, Juily and August), we see an average minimum temperature of 8 degreees celcius, while the average humidity level at 9 am is around 80.3% and 72% at 3 pm for this period. Together this can significantly affect the comfort levels in your home, making a comprehensive heating system essential not just for warmth but also for managing indoor humidity levels. About Big Hill

Big Hill, located in VIC, 3231, experiences a cool and temperate climate throughout the year. The average winter weather in Big Hill is characterized by mild temperatures, making it essential for residents to have proper heating systems in place.

The average minimum temperature in Big Hill varies by month. In June, the coldest month, the average minimum temperature is around 6°C. Other winter months like July and August also have average minimum temperatures below 10°C. The yearly minimum temperature in Big Hill can drop as low as 2°C, emphasizing the need for reliable heating solutions.

To meet the heating requirements of Big Hill, local heating businesses offer a range of options, including split system heating. Split systems are an ideal choice for this region as they provide efficient heating and cooling all year round. These systems consist of an indoor unit that distributes warm air and an outdoor unit that extracts heat from the outside air. With the ability to operate in reverse, split systems can also cool the indoor space during hot summer months.

Moreover, considering the ample sunshine in Big Hill, residents can harness solar power to run their heating and cooling systems. By installing solar panels, homeowners can reduce their reliance on traditional energy sources and enjoy the benefits of renewable energy while keeping their homes comfortable.
